Water Damage Restoration Cost in Cleveland Heights, OH

The cost of water damage restoration can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Cleveland Heights, OH. Here are some estimated price ranges for different services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Cleaning and disinfecting $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ning products used
Repair and re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ials used
Final inspection and certification $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of the job
Emergency response and assessment $200 – $1,000 Time of day, distance to the property
More services (e.g. Mold remediation, odor removal) $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of service required

The cost of water damage restoration can vary widely depending on the specific services required and the severity of the damage. Can I prevent water damage from occurring in the first place?

Yes, there are several steps you can take to prevent water damage from occurring in the first place. These include:

Regularly inspecting your property for signs of water damage

Fixing leaks quickly

Installing a sump pump and backup system

Using a water detection system

Regularly cleaning and maintaining your gutters and downspouts
